About the Organisation

NALSAR University of Law, Hyderabad, is one of India’s premier legal institutions, renowned for its academic excellence, research contributions, and vibrant student community. With an illustrious alumni base across the globe, NALSAR is committed to nurturing a lasting relationship with its former students.

To further this commitment, applications are invited for the position of ‘Director - Alumni Relations & Internationalisation’ to lead the university’s alumni engagement efforts while also developing and implementing the University’s internationalisation strategy.

Role Summary

The Director - Alumni Relations & Internationalisation will be responsible for planning, coordinating, and executing initiatives that build meaningful and sustainable connections between the university and its alumni. This role involves extensive communication, event coordination, data management, and strategic outreach to enhance alumni involvement at NALSAR. This office will also focus upon International Affairs of the university and help foster relationships with our global partners.

Responsibilities:

This is a leadership role and it is expected that the successful applicant can undertake the following work with a significant degree of independence.

  • Develop and implement alumni engagement strategies, communications, and events.
  • Serve as a liaison between the alumni community and academic and administrative departments in the University. Collaborate with departments to encourage alumni participation in mentorship, internships, and other initiatives.
  • Strategize and coordinate alumni events such as reunions, networking sessions, guest lectures, etc.
  • Develop strategies and ideas to keep the alumni updated about developments in the University along with enhancing social media strategies for alumni engagement.
  • Develop and implement strategies towards alumni giving (financially and otherwise).
  • Develop forums for alumni-University interactions towards deepening engagement. For example, for structural feedback on syllabus revision and any other contribution for the development of the University.
  • Develop, maintain and update the alumni database and ensure data accuracy and security.
  • Assist in developing and managing international academic partnerships and MoUs.
  • Liaise with embassies, universities, and international organisations for collaborative opportunities.
  • Serve as a focal point of contact for our current and prospective international students and academic partners.
  • Ensure the exchange programmes on offer by NALSAR and their respective counterpart universities are streamlined and develop further relations with more institutions across the world.

Essential Criteria:

  • Master’s degree or above.
  • Minimum 10 years of relevant and demonstrable experience in student / alumni relations, international affairs, or academic administration or experience of working in a similar role.
  • Experience in event planning, stakeholder engagement, and cross-cultural communication.
  • Demonstrable knowledge and interest in the higher education sector.
